本系统(程序+源码+数据库+调试部署+开发环境)带论文文档1万字以上,文末可获取,系统界面在最后面。
系统程序文件列表
系统内容;学生,教师,通知公告,考试成绩,课堂成绩,教师消息,消息回复,在线提问,提问解答
开题报告内容
一、项目背景与意义
随着教育信息化的快速发展,学生成绩管理已成为学校日常工作中不可或缺的一部分。传统的手工管理方式存在效率低、易出错等问题。因此,开发一个基于Spring Boot的学生成绩管理与分析系统,旨在提高成绩管理的效率和准确性,同时为教师提供便捷的成绩分析功能,有助于优化教学策略和提升教学质量。
二、项目目标与内容
本项目旨在实现一个功能完善的学生成绩管理与分析系统,包括学生信息管理、课程信息管理、成绩录入与查询、成绩统计分析等模块。通过该系统,教师可以方便地录入和查询学生成绩,生成各类统计分析报表;学生可以查看自己的成绩和排名;管理员则可以对系统进行全面管理。
三、技术路线与实现方法
本项目采用Spring Boot框架进行开发,利用其强大的依赖注入和配置管理功能,提高开发效率和系统稳定性。数据库方面,选用MySQL进行数据存储,确保数据的安全性和完整性。前端采用HTML、CSS和JavaScript等技术,实现友好的用户界面交互。同时,将采用图表库(如ECharts)进行成绩统计分析的可视化展示。
四、预期成果与效益
通过本项目的实施,将形成一个功能全面、操作简便的学生成绩管理与分析系统,为学校提供高效、准确的成绩管理工具。该系统不仅有助于提高教学管理水平,还能为教师的教学改进提供有力支持,进而推动学校整体教学质量的提升。
进度安排:
第1周:明确毕业设计任务书要求,查阅相关资料,完成英文翻译,开题。
第2周:完成系统的需求分析,通过用例图或数据流程图等进行描述。
第3周:完成系统的总体设计,绘制系统功能模块图。
第4-5周:完成系统的数据库设计,绘制E-R图,设计表结构,建立数据库和表。
第6周:撰写中期方案及中期报告,中期检查。
第7-10周: 完成系统的详细设计和测试。
第11-12周:整理和编制各种明细表,撰写说明书(论文)等技术文件。
第12周:整理、总结,上交毕业设计(论文),准备毕业答辩工作。
第13-14周:评阅、毕业设计答辩。